Announcing the Samsung Gear 360 Camcorder

0
Samsung has released a few new products today, and among them is the Gear 360, a standalone camera that can shoot photos and video in 360-degrees. This device, with its spherical form factor, has two lenses that capture 180-degrees on each side, with software stitching them together for a full image.
